Led Zeppelin, formed in 1968 by Robert Plant, Jimmy Page, John Paul Jones, and John Bonham, revolutionized rock with their electrifying sound, blending blues, folk, and hard rock. Hits like “Stairway to Heaven,” “Kashmir,” and “Whole Lotta Love” cemented their place in history as one of the greatest rock bands of all time. However, the tragic death of drummer John Bonham in 1980 led to the band’s disbandment, with Plant embarking on a successful solo career.
